Key Responsibilities:
Ingest and process global news media, broadcasts, podcasts, and social media in real-time.
Design cutting-edge Generative AI solutions for communications professionals to create and analyze content.
Create robust search and monitoring mechanisms to track brand mentions and industry trends.
Develop intuitive reporting tools to convert complex data into actionable insights.
Craft a seamless User Experience (UX) for our internal customers.

Basic Qualifications:
3+ years of professional software development experience.
2+ years of design or architecture experience for new and existing systems.
Proficiency in at least one programming language.
Knowledge of software engineering best practices and the full software development life cycle.
Experience with distributed systems, algorithms, and databases.
Preferred Qualifications:
3+ years of full software development life cycle experience.
Bachelor's degree in computer science or a related field.
Experience with search technologies, especially OpenSearch.
Familiarity with Generative AI, Natural Language Processing, or Machine Learning techniques.
